Impact of Sleep Disorders on Cognitive Function in Stroke: A Systematic Review and Meta-analysis

Background:
Stroke sleep disorders have negative effects on physiological function, readmission rate and mortality. However, the effects on cognitive function were inconsistent. This study aims to identify the impact of sleep disorders on cognitive functions in stroke, and the relationship between types of sleep disorders and cognitive disorders.
Methods:
This systematic review and meta-analysis searched PubMed, the Cochrane Library, Web of Science, Embase, Chinese Biomedical Database (CBM), CNKI, Wanfang and VIP Database from inception until October 13, 2024. Using Revman 5.3 software to combine the odds ratios (ORs) and standardized mean differences (SMDs) reported in the study separately. Quality assessment, heterogeneity, and sensitivity analyses were also involved.
Results:
There were 6 longitudinal studies and 10 cross-sectional studies involving 5,779 patients. Longitudinal studies showed that stroke patients with sleep disorders were more likely to have cognitive impairment [OR = 2.35, 95% CI (1.67, 3.31), I2 = 0%, p > .1]. Cross-sectional studies showed the same results [OR = 2.45, 95% CI (1.77, 3.40), I2 = 65%, p < .1], and the results did not change much [OR = 2.62, 95% CI (2.15, 3.20), I2 = 0%, p > .1] after the deletion of the literature that caused high heterogeneity. Age has a significant effect on cognition in stroke patients with sleep disorders (p < .1). Egger's test showed no significant publication bias (p > .1).
Conclusions:
Sleep disorders are associated factors affecting cognitive impairment in stroke patients, and the older the age, the greater the negative effect.
